Abstract
The invention discloses a urea sensor structure. The urea sensor structure comprises a sensor top seat, wherein the sensor top seat is connected with a urea suction pipe orifice, a urea returning pipe orifice and a pair of water interfaces, an information tube is welded at the center of the bottom of the sensor top seat, the bottom of the information tube is connected with a tray, an end cap is welded in a pipe orifice at the bottom of the information tube, a floater is installed on the information tube in sliding mode, the bottom of the sensor top seat is connected with two pipe ends of a spiral pipe, two pipe orifices of the spiral pipe are respectively communicated with the two water interfaces, the lower portion of the pipe body of the spiral pipe forms a vertical spiral shape with the information tube as the center shaft, the bottom of the sensor top seat is further connected with a pair of urea pipes, the top ends of the two urea pipes are respectively communicated with the urea suction pipe orifice and the urea returning pipe orifice, a filter screen injection molding part is arranged in an annular flange on the edge of the tray, and a filter screen is sleeved on the filter screen injection molding part. The urea sensor structure is reasonable in structural configuration, stable and reliable, and good in tightness, and furthermore use life of a urea sensor is greatly improved.

Background technology
Urea sensor is arranged on carriage frame side, directly contacts external environment, and working temperature is between-44 ℃~+ 85 ℃.Urea sensor head shell is exposed in urea box external body, the rugged surroundings such as drenched with rain all the year round and be exposed to the sun impact, and urea sensor pipeline in urea box, has very strong corrosivity all the year round.Due to its unreasonable structure, there is low problem in serviceable life in prior art urea sensor.

In the present invention, adopt pallet welding, convenient fixing water inlet pipe and water outlet pipe, urea tube, message tube and net-filter assembly, good reliability guarantees that float and periphery tube wall gap are even simultaneously.
In the present invention, sensor footstock and Inlet and outlet water joint, enter back urea joint, its structure all adopts ultrasonic welding process design, guarantees soldering reliability and impermeability.
In the present invention, sensor footstock and each interface, mouth of pipe junction adopt slip-off preventing broached-tooth design to increase product serviceable life, have improved product reliability.
In the present invention, filter screen adopts and pallet diameter matching circular structure, and entirety is more attractive in appearance, and breach is offered at filter screen moulding edge, guarantees that filter screen inside is penetrating.Pallet has good protective effect to filter screen simultaneously.
